Overclocking Potential and VRM Design Explained

Overclocking, the art of pushing your components beyond their specified limits, can unlock hidden performance reserves in your 12900K. But to safely and effectively overclock, a robust VRM (Voltage Regulator Module) design on your motherboard is absolutely essential. Think of the VRM as the unsung hero, delivering clean and stable power to your CPU.

A well-designed VRM consists of high-quality components, including chokes, capacitors, and MOSFETs. These components work together to convert the motherboard’s input voltage into the precise voltage required by the CPU. A higher number of VRM phases generally indicates a more robust power delivery system, capable of handling the increased power demands of overclocking.

Why is this important? Imagine you’re pushing your 12900K to its limits. The CPU demands more power, and a weak VRM can struggle to deliver it consistently. This can lead to instability, crashes, or even permanent damage to your CPU. A strong VRM ensures that the CPU receives a stable and clean power supply, even under extreme loads, allowing you to overclock with confidence.

So, when selecting a DDR5 motherboard for your 12900K, pay close attention to the VRM design. Look for motherboards with a high number of VRM phases, high-quality components, and adequate cooling. This will not only enable you to push your CPU further but also ensure its long-term reliability. A little research into VRM design can save you a lot of headaches down the road.

Connectivity Options: Beyond the Basics

Beyond the obvious USB ports and audio jacks, let’s explore the connectivity options that can elevate your computing experience. Modern motherboards offer a plethora of features that can significantly enhance your workflow and entertainment. Think of these extras as icing on the cake – nice to have, and in some cases, essential.

For starters, consider the number and type of USB ports. Do you need multiple USB 3.2 Gen 2 ports for lightning-fast data transfers from external drives? Perhaps you require USB Type-C ports with Thunderbolt support for connecting high-resolution displays and professional audio interfaces? Make sure the motherboard has the right mix of ports to accommodate your peripherals.

Next, delve into the realm of networking. While Gigabit Ethernet is still common, many high-end motherboards now feature 2.5GbE or even 10GbE ports for blazing-fast wired network speeds. This can be particularly beneficial for gamers who stream, content creators who transfer large files, or anyone who demands the lowest possible latency. Wi-Fi is equally important, especially if you prefer a wireless connection. Look for motherboards with the latest Wi-Fi 6E or Wi-Fi 7 standards for faster speeds and improved range.

Finally, don’t overlook the importance of storage connectivity. M.2 slots are essential for connecting NVMe SSDs, which offer significantly faster speeds than traditional SATA drives. Some motherboards even feature multiple M.2 slots, allowing you to create a high-performance storage array. Consider the number of M.2 slots, the supported PCIe Gen version, and whether they have heatsinks to prevent thermal throttling. Matching your motherboard’s connectivity to your needs can dramatically improve your computer’s overall functionality and performance.

Can I use my old DDR4 RAM with these DDR5 motherboards?

Unfortunately, no, you can’t use DDR4 RAM with DDR5 motherboards. The two memory types have different physical connectors and electrical requirements, making them incompatible. It’s like trying to plug a USB-C cable into a USB-A port – they just don’t fit!

When upgrading to an i9-12900K, you’ll need to invest in a new set of DDR5 RAM. While this might add to the initial cost, the performance benefits of DDR5, along with the increased longevity of your system, make it a worthwhile investment in the long run.

What is the deal with PCIe 5.0, and do I really need it right now?

PCIe 5.0 is the latest generation of the PCI Express interface, offering double the bandwidth of PCIe 4.0. This is particularly relevant for graphics cards and high-speed storage devices. Think of it as a super-fast lane on the data highway, allowing for even quicker transfer rates.

While there aren’t many PCIe 5.0 devices currently available, having a motherboard with PCIe 5.0 support future-proofs your system. As new graphics cards and SSDs are released that utilize PCIe 5.0, you’ll be ready to take advantage of their increased performance without needing to upgrade your motherboard. It’s an investment for the future!

What is the best way to update the BIOS on these motherboards?

Updating the BIOS is generally a straightforward process, but it’s essential to follow the manufacturer’s instructions carefully. Most modern motherboards offer multiple methods for updating the BIOS, including a built-in utility within the BIOS itself, or via a USB flash drive. Some even have a BIOS flashback feature that allows you to update the BIOS without even having a CPU installed!

Always download the latest BIOS version from the motherboard manufacturer’s website, making sure it’s specifically for your motherboard model. Follow the instructions in the motherboard manual or on the manufacturer’s website closely. A corrupted BIOS update can render your motherboard unusable, so double-check everything before you proceed!
